Awesome performing sedan

58K miles, and still rides like new. Twin turbo V-8 Xdrive is an awesome combination. This car exceeds my expectations, as it is incredibly fast/powerful for a full sized sedan. Zero to 60 in under 4 seconds! Love the hatchback design, which allows versatility, providing a great replacement for the 3 series wagon I owned prior. No mechanical issues so far. 7 series chassis on this car’s platform makes a long road trip a pleasure to drive. BMW sure got this one right!

This car is a swiss army knife

When we replaced our 2008 Cadillac SRX with this car, I was concerned that we should have bought another SUV. I was wrong. This car does everything we want and more. We wanted a powerful V8 and this one is awesome. We needed space to carry stuff in the back (like an SUV) and so far, everything has fit with room to spare. We wanted comfort, ease of entry, and current tech, and this car has all that in spades. It's important to remember that although the GT was originally positioned as a 5 series (and currently as a 6 series), it's built on a 7 series platform - so it's big. It's also kind of exclusive, as there aren't many on the road, if that's important to you. After 6 months of ownership, we couldn't be happier.

What is the MPG of the 2014 BMW 550 Gran Turismo?

The 2014 BMW 550 Gran Turismo offers up to 16 MPG in city driving and 25 MPG on the highway. These figures are based on EPA mileage ratings and are for comparison purposes only. The actual mileage will vary depending on vehicle options, trim level, driving conditions, driving habits, vehicle maintenance, and other factors.
